Tacos with Tomato Corn Salsa and Spicy Nut Meat
Instructions
1. Tear off the cabbage or lettuce leaves gently to form taco shells.
2. To make the salsa: chop the tomatoes as roughly or finely as you like. Slice the corn off the cob. Mince the basil and juice the lime. Throw everything together, including the pepper.
3. To make the nut meat: finely chop the nuts and seeds then toss in the tamari and spices.
4. Fill your taco shells with the salsa and nut meat.
Ingredients
Taco shells:
1 small savoy cabbage or lettuce
Salsa:
4 tomatoes
2 cobs of corn
1 cup packed basil leaves
2 limes
¼ tsp black pepper
Nut meat:
1/3 cup pecans (or any nuts)
1/3 cup sunflower seeds (or any seeds)
¾ tsp turmeric powder
¾ tsp cumin powder
1/8 tsp or more chili powder, if desired
1 tsp tamari or soy sauce
